Shower installation projects typically involve a range of tasks, including removing existing fixtures, preparing the space, installing new shower units, and finishing with proper sealing and waterproofing. The scope of work can vary depending on the type of shower chosen-whether it’s a standard enclosure, custom tile design, or walk-in model-as well as the complexity of the existing bathroom setup. Clearly defining what the project entails helps property owners communicate their expectations and ensures that contractors understand the specific requirements, reducing the risk of misunderstandings or incomplete work.

- Verify the contractor’s experience with shower installation projects similar in scope and complexity. - Ensure the service providers clearly define the scope of work and materials included in the project description.
- Check that the contractor provides a detailed written estimate outlining the work to be performed and materials to be used. - Confirm that the scope, responsibilities, and expectations are documented to prevent misunderstandings.
- Assess the contractor’s reputation through reviews, references, or portfolio examples of completed shower installations. - Look for consistency and quality in their previous work to gauge reliability and craftsmanship.
- Ensure the contractor discusses plumbing, waterproofing, and tile installation requirements upfront. - Clear communication about technical aspects helps set realistic expectations for the project.
- Ask how the contractor plans to handle permits, inspections, or code compliance requirements relevant to shower installation. - Understanding their approach to regulatory adherence ensures the project meets local standards.
- Confirm that the contractor will provide a written contract detailing scope, materials, and terms before starting work. - A comprehensive agreement helps establish clear expectations and protect all parties involved.

When evaluating contractors for shower installation,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about the types of showers the service providers have installed in the past, paying attention to the complexity and scale of those jobs. Contractors with a history of handling shower upgrades, replacements, or custom designs are more likely to understand the specific requirements and challenges involved. This familiarity can help ensure that the installation process proceeds smoothly and meets the homeowner’s expectations.
A clear, written scope of work is essential when comparing different service providers. Homeowners should seek detailed descriptions of what each contractor plans to do, including materials to be used, specific tasks involved, and any preparatory or finishing work.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a basis for evaluating the thoroughness and professionalism of each contractor’s approach. It also allows homeowners to identify any gaps or ambiguities that could lead to issues later on.

How can I compare contractors for shower installation? To compare contractors, review their experience, verify references, and check for clear written estimates that outline the scope of work and materials involved.
What should I consider when defining the scope of my shower installation project? Clearly outline your desired shower size, style, fixtures, and any additional features to ensure contractors understand your expectations and can provide accurate proposals.
How can I verify a contractor’s experience with shower installations? Ask for details about their previous projects, request references, and review any available portfolios or customer feedback related to shower installation work.
Why is it important to have the project scope in writing? Having the scope documented helps prevent misunderstandings, ensures all parties agree on the work to be performed, and provides a basis for project completion expectations.
What questions should I ask contractors before hiring for shower installation? Inquire about their experience, request details about the process, clarify what is included in their service, and discuss how they handle unexpected issues or changes during the project.
How can I ensure the contractor I choose is reliable? Review their references, verify their experience with similar projects, and ensure they provide a detailed, written scope of work to establish clear expectations.
